Vendor: BalluffSKU: BES048JBalluff’s magnetic-field-resistant inductive sensors are ideal for use in areas with strong magnetic fields such as in welding and induction hardening installations. They are insensitive to magnetic fields arising from electric welding currents up to 25 kA.
